Transferring Money to China: 11 Questions Answered

What services do banks offer for money transfers to China?

Sending money to China doesn't have to be difficult or expensive. Banks offer a variety of services to make international money transfers easier and cheaper. Here are some of the services banks offer for money transfers to China.

The first option is a wire transfer. This is the most common method used for international money transfers and it's also one of the fastest. All you need to do is provide the recipient’s bank information and the amount you want to send. Your bank will then take care of the rest.

You can also use foreign exchange services when sending money to China. Foreign exchange companies offer competitive exchange rates, allowing you to keep more of your money when transferring it overseas. They also charge lower fees than many banks, making them a great choice for those looking to save money.

If you prefer not to send money through a bank, you can always use a remittance service. Remittance services provide fast, secure, and low-cost transfers to China. You'll typically have to pay a flat fee for the transfers, which can be as low as a few cents per dollar transferred.

No matter what services you choose, make sure to compare the different options available to you to find the best rate and lowest fees. Remember to read all the terms and conditions before committing to any service so that you know what you're getting into. With the right service, sending money to China can be simple and stress-free.

Is there a limit on how much money I can transfer to China in one transaction?

Transferring money to China has become more convenient in recent years, and the amount that can be transferred in one transaction is no exception. But there are limits on how much money you can transfer to China in one transaction.

China’s banking regulations require that all transfers must comply with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Counter Financing of Terrorism (CFT) rules, which puts limits on the size of a transaction.

The daily remittance limit for individuals is 50,000 yuan, while the annual limit is 500,000 yuan. It is important to note that these amounts are subject to change without notice, so check with your bank before you make a transfer.

It is also important to understand the Chinese government's restrictions on foreign exchange. According to the State Administration of Foreign Exchange, individuals must pay taxes on any amounts over US$50,000 when transferring money from abroad.

Fortunately, many remittance businesses offer services that help to minimize the hassle of sending large sums of money to China in just one transaction. These companies have expertise in cross-border payment processing and use the most secure methods to get your transfer done, quickly and safely.

If you need to transfer a large sum of money to China, it is best to work with a reputable remittance provider who can assist you in navigating through the regulations and ensure a safe and successful transfer.

Are there special requirements when transferring money to China?

Transferring money to China is a great way to send money abroad quickly and efficiently. However, there are certain requirements that must be met in order for the transfer to be successful. This article will discuss what those requirements are and how to make sure that your international money transfer to China is successful.

One of the most important requirements for transferring money to China is that the receiver must have a valid bank account in the country. They should also have a Chinese ID number so that the funds can be properly credited to their account. In addition, the sender must also provide their bank details, such as the name of their bank, the account number, and the swift code.

Another requirement when transferring money to China is that the exchange rate needs to be taken into account. Exchange rates may fluctuate, so be sure to check the exchange rate before making the transfer. This will ensure that the amount sent is exactly the amount received by the recipient. Additionally, some banks may charge a fee for international transfers, so make sure to ask your bank if this is the case.

Finally, it is important to note that transferring money to China usually requires some paperwork. This may include a formal application form or other documents. Be sure to prepared these documents before you make the transfer and check with the Chinese bank to make sure all is in order.

By following these guidelines, your international money transfer to China should go smoothly and be successful. With the right preparation, you can make sure that your money transfers to Chinese without any problems.
